Features for the SN65HVD485E
- Bus-pin ESD protection up to 15 kV
- 1/2 Unit load: up to 64 nodes on a bus
- Bus-open-failsafe receiver
- Glitch-free power-up and power-down bus inputs and outputs
- Available in small VSSOP-8 package
- Meets or exceeds the requirements of the TIA/EIA-485A standard
- Industry-standard SN75176 footprint
Description for the SN65HVD485E
The SN65HVD485E device is a half-duplex transceiver designed for RS-485 data bus networks. Powered by a 5-V supply, it is fully compliant with the TIA/EIA-485A standard. This device is suitable for data transmission up to 10 Mbps over long twisted-pair cables and is designed to operate with very low supply current, typically less than 2 mA, exclusive of the load. When the device is in the inactive shutdown mode, the supply current drops below 1 mA.
The wide common-mode range and high ESD protection levels of this device make it suitable for demanding applications such as: electrical inverters, status/command signals across telecom racks, cabled chassis interconnects, and industrial automation networks where noise tolerance is essential. The SN65HVD485E device matches the industry-standard footprint of the SN75176 device. Power-on reset circuits keep the outputs in a high-impedance state until the supply voltage has stabilized. A thermal-shutdown function protects the device from damage due to system-fault conditions. The SN65HVD485E device is characterized for operation from –40°C to 85°C air temperature.
